Output 8e27940e49c9bc64b97246d2e338590b7fd809e78418919b5ba252e7b8e542ea:1

value
56501802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 227c851c45b7bc7dcad6f4f682491b92b694ee56 OP_EQUAL
address
34qN4s7126m5PjaiQ53WDubWy8WzxyzAbC
transaction
8e27940e49c9bc64b97246d2e338590b7fd809e78418919b5ba252e7b8e542ea
confirmations
305213
spent
true